Artikeln belyser att traditionella serverprogrammeringstekniker är ineffektiva för mobiltelefoner, främst på grund av den höga batteriförbrukningen som orsakas av mobilradion. Mobilradion är en av de största batteritjuvarna; varje dataöverföring, oavsett storlek, aktiverar radion i 20-30 sekunder, vilket dränerar batteriet snabbt vid frekventa små överföringar. För att optimera batteritiden är det avgörande att förstå mobilradions tillståndsmaskin och minimera antalet radioaktiveringar genom att samla och schemalägga dataöverföringar (den så kallade 'big cookie'-modellen). Tekniker som förhämtning (prefetching) av data, analys av applikationens batteriprofil, och att anpassa överföringar efter enhetens tillstånd (t.ex. vid laddning) kan dramatiskt förbättra batteriprestandan. Reto Meier, tech lead för Android developer relations team, har skapat en serie instruktionsvideor som detaljerat förklarar dessa principer och tekniker för effektiv dataöverföring på mobila enheter.